A lot of you don`t really seem to understand how a business operates. A business doesn`t live on goodwill, hard work and fighting spirit like Gurren Lagann, they operate on money. They have to have cashflow. For that to happen, they have to have people buy their products.

People here whine that Odex doesn`t carry XX YY title or ZZ title`s subs suck balls, or their encoding is worse than a microwave oven when compared to fansubs.

But you have to understand that a fansub has TEAM operating behind it, and those people burn off 12 hour runs or more per person on the team. That means the translator, editor, typesetter, copy check, QC and encoder all run at the same time and burn the midnight oil on that. If there`s up to 10 people on 1 team, that`s like 120 manhours used to create just 1 episode. And that`s only 1 episode and each team only works like once or twice a week on about 2 series?

Odex doesn`t have the financial means to put that much manpower behind a single episode, given that they have to carry so many titles into Singapore. They don`t only have to pay for the translation and packaging and sale, they also have to pay for licensing costs, promotion, distribution.
It`s simply not fair to compare the two together. One is an outfit run off passion and doesn`t have a bottomline, while the other is a corporate entity that has to have cashflow.

If you don`t support their products and stuff, and whine that their quality is crap, their library is puny, where are they to find the cash to improve on their products further?
It`s not like their asses can print money and they`re not a really big company to begin with.
That they`ve taken steps to do 1 week delay broadcasting on television is already quite a step forward. Even Channel 5 doesn`t have 1 week delay for Heroes or Desperate Housewives.

As for subs, censoring and stuff, they don`t only have to contend with lack of fluent subtitlers[Singaporean Chinese are taught English and Mandarin at a young age, but how many of them can actually speak both fluently? How many banana Chinese friends do you know?], they also have to contend with MDA regarding content and phrasing.

Fansubbers burn the midnight oil to rush the latest episodes. The problem with Odex subbing already started when they were doing DVD releases of shows that were aired in Japan months (even years?) ago.

Even with simulcasting, to say Odex hasn't the financial means to compete with fansubbers' doesn't change the fact that they are running a business, and thus are ultimately responsible for the quality of their products.

Do you think it's right for a company to sell you a bug-ridden piece of software just because they can't afford to hire enough beta-testers? Or a restaurant serves you a crappy dish just because the owner couldn't pay for enough kitchen helpers? Odex is a business, and businesses have a olbigation towards their customers. How they're going to meet that is, unfortunately, not of interest to the customers.

Bottomline is simple. If you don't have the finances to do proper quality control, then maybe it's time to scale back your business for the moment. I've seen my share of companies that compromised on quality to expand their brands more aggressively--only to backfire.

The only reason why Odex gets away with it is because they're a monopoly, much like how Microsoft gets away with selling us defective operation systems. And like how most of us hate Microsoft for their arrogance, people have come to despise Odex not just for their lack of quality control, but also their high-handed approach to the fansub community.

Fansubs (and open source software, in the case of Microsoft) are the only alternative that keeps Odex on their toes. They are the benchmark for the anime community, and now that Odex can't beat them at their game, they're hoping to literally bash them out of it. For that, they've lost my respect.

Just look at the recent article in Life! ("Instant Anime"). What we have here is the first-ever same-time simulcast in Tears to Tiara, and what has Peter Go--and Odex's favourite press, Straits Times, choose to pre-empt by harping back on the "illegal downloading" subject again, ad nauseum.


Just remember: Apple's iTunes has grown in popularity and acceptance among Net users. And they got there without having to bring out the hatchet.
